Overall fun course. The 'Dude's Clubhouse' has great food and drink selections upstairs and bar room downstairs. The pro shop and check-in is behind the clubhouse, it offers a great selection of all golfing needs and enjoyment. The practice putting green is in-between the pro shop and clubhouse which is pretty much in the way of everyone coming and going. The driving range is off left of the first tee, anything goes left off Hole 1 and you are probably SOL finding it while dodging people practicing. The Tee-Boxes overall are flat and not too beat up. With no obvious stakes marking distances, having a gps/rangefinder or finding one of the Sprinkler covers for the yardage is a mist. Challenging undulating fairways deceive the eye on a few holes giving the appearance of an object or the green being closer than it really is. The fairway and greenside bunkers add another level danger as they take no prisoners. Smaller than expected greens on some of the par 4 and 5's demand an on-line iron or wedge shot in. The Par 3's have the largest greens and are inviting to take on the flag, even #17 over the tree. Overall a fun course that is inviting for the long hitter and accurate wedge players.
